The average of n numbers x1,x2,x3,,xn is M. If xn is replaced by x', then new average is

a
M−xn+x′
b
nM−xn+x′n
c
(n−1)M+x′n
d
M−xn+x′n

detailed solution

Correct option is B

M=x1+x2+x3……xnn⇒ nM=x1+x2+x3+…+xn−1+xn⇒ nM−xn=x1+x2+x3+…+xn−1⇒ nM−xn+x′=x1+x2+x3+…+xn−1+x′⇒ nM−xn+x′n=x1+x2+x3+…+xn−1+x′n∴ New average=nM−xn+x′n
